Buying from Local Suppliers
The restaurant’s dedication to sustainability begins with its thoughtfully assembled network of regional suppliers and artisanal suppliers. Rather than using conventional wholesale distributors, the venue has built strong partnerships with local farms, fisheries, and artisanal producers. This approach not only ensures superior ingredient standards and freshness, but also substantially decreases the carbon footprint associated with long-distance transportation. By supporting local suppliers, the restaurant guarantees that every dish embodies the authentic flavours and seasonal character of the local landscape.
These collaborative relationships extend far beyond simple business dealings. The chef regularly visits supplier sites to grasp production methods, discuss sustainability practices, and provide constructive feedback. This transparency builds mutual respect and allows producers to gain acknowledgment for their efforts. Furthermore, the restaurant features rotating menus that highlight seasonal availability, educating diners about the seasonal patterns of local agriculture. Such practices reinforce local ties whilst demonstrating that culinary excellence and ecological responsibility are entirely compatible objectives within the contemporary hospitality industry.
People at the Centre of the Establishment
The restaurant’s dedication to neighbourhood participation extends far beyond merely delivering outstanding food. Chef and proprietor have purposefully structured the space to function as a genuine neighbourhood hub, organising ongoing occasions that highlight neighbourhood creativity and foster authentic bonds amongst patrons. From culinary workshops presenting neighbouring producers to shared dining occasions with local organisations, the restaurant consciously develops an inclusive atmosphere where guests experience authentic belonging and respected as part of an extended family.
Educational programmes form a cornerstone of the restaurant’s community-focused philosophy. The venue frequently provides workshops covering sustainable cooking techniques, knowledge of nutrition, and environmental stewardship to people of all ages and backgrounds. By making culinary knowledge accessible and empowering individuals to make informed food decisions, the restaurant moves past its profit-driven purpose and acts as a force for constructive changes in behaviour throughout the local community, fostering lasting transformations in how groups approach dietary practices.
Furthermore, the establishment sustains robust relationships with local charities, food banks, and social enterprises, guaranteeing surplus ingredients benefit vulnerable populations. Staff members are strongly supported to volunteer within the community, whilst a percentage of profits contributes to neighbourhood programmes and environmental protection projects. This integrated model demonstrates that restaurants can run successfully whilst meaningfully contributing societal wellbeing and ecological sustainability simultaneously.
